Added a little more info.
the machine is 2P * 4core* HT NHM EP with 12GB memory, and THP set 'always'.

>

> Here is the macro benchmark to measure munmap change:
> 
> tlb_flushall_shift = -1
> [alexs@lkp-ne04 tlb]$ 
> [alexs@lkp-ne04 tlb]$ for t in `echo 4 8 16  `; do echo "=============== t = $t ===================="; for i in `echo  8 16 32  `; do sudo  ./munmap -t $t -n $i; done done
> =============== t = 4 ====================
> munmap use 164ms 5032ns/time, memory access uses 81605 times/thread/ms, cost 12ns/time
> munmap use 86ms 5251ns/time, memory access uses 83378 times/thread/ms, cost 11ns/time
> munmap use 46ms 5642ns/time, memory access uses 87212 times/thread/ms, cost 11ns/time
> =============== t = 8 ====================
> munmap use 197ms 6036ns/time, memory access uses 69295 times/thread/ms, cost 14ns/time
> munmap use 96ms 5896ns/time, memory access uses 71895 times/thread/ms, cost 13ns/time
> munmap use 62ms 7608ns/time, memory access uses 83895 times/thread/ms, cost 11ns/time
> =============== t = 16 ====================
> munmap use 274ms 8367ns/time, memory access uses 37860 times/thread/ms, cost 26ns/time
> munmap use 139ms 8543ns/time, memory access uses 38137 times/thread/ms, cost 26ns/time
> munmap use 74ms 9033ns/time, memory access uses 38349 times/thread/ms, cost 26ns/time
> [alexs@lkp-ne04 tlb]$ 
> [alexs@lkp-ne04 tlb]$ 
> tlb_flushall_shift = 5
> [alexs@lkp-ne04 tlb]$ for t in `echo 4 8 16  `; do echo "=============== t = $t ===================="; for i in `echo  8 16 32  `; do sudo  ./munmap -t $t -n $i; done done
> =============== t = 4 ====================
> munmap use 212ms 6485ns/time, memory access uses 114003 times/thread/ms, cost 8ns/time
> munmap use 130ms 7972ns/time, memory access uses 110725 times/thread/ms, cost 9ns/time
> munmap use 45ms 5581ns/time, memory access uses 87866 times/thread/ms, cost 11ns/time
> =============== t = 8 ====================
> munmap use 253ms 7734ns/time, memory access uses 94578 times/thread/ms, cost 10ns/time
> munmap use 147ms 9012ns/time, memory access uses 83851 times/thread/ms, cost 11ns/time
> munmap use 63ms 7713ns/time, memory access uses 87473 times/thread/ms, cost 11ns/time
> =============== t = 16 ====================
> munmap use 369ms 11284ns/time, memory access uses 38854 times/thread/ms, cost 25ns/time
> munmap use 264ms 16131ns/time, memory access uses 37870 times/thread/ms, cost 26ns/time
> munmap use 73ms 8981ns/time, memory access uses 38309 times/thread/ms, cost 26ns/time
